录音文件识别促销活动主要涉及语音识别技术和自然语言处理技术。以下是对该问题的详细解答:
语音识别:将人类的语音转换为计算机可读的文本格式。 自然语言处理(NLP):使计算机能够理解和生成人类语言的技术。
问题1:识别准确率不高
原因:可能是由于录音质量不佳、背景噪音干扰或使用了不合适的模型。
问题2:处理速度慢
原因:可能是数据量过大,或者使用的算法效率不高。
针对问题1:
针对问题2:
以下是一个简单的示例代码,展示如何使用Python进行语音识别:
import speech_recognition as sr
# 创建识别器对象
r = sr.Recognizer()
# 加载录音文件
audio_file = "path_to_your_audio_file.wav"
with sr.AudioFile(audio_file) as source:
audio_data = r.record(source)
# 使用Google Web Speech API进行识别
try:
text = r.recognize_google(audio_data, language='zh-CN')
print("识别结果:", text)
except sr.UnknownValueError:
print("无法识别音频")
except sr.RequestError as e:
print(f"请求错误: {e}")
总之,录音文件识别促销活动是一个结合了语音识别和自然语言处理的复杂任务,但通过合理的技术选型和优化措施,可以实现高效准确的处理效果。